The Opportunity
This is more than just a job; it’s a mission.
As a Lead DevOps Engineer, you will play a pivotal role in designing, developing and maintaining the critical CI/CD infrastructure that powers our services. You’ll be self‑driven, organised and passionate about building elegant, stable and scalable solutions.
You’ll work across a wide variety of exciting projects with complex challenges, contributing to core solutions that have meaningful, real‑world impact. You’ll also bring strong leadership, guiding your team through both technical and delivery challenges to ensure customer needs are met.
“My purpose is to lead a team of engineers, rise to the challenges presented, push the boundaries and define possible together.”
– Matthew Bullock, Software Manager, Northrop Grumman UK
What You’ll Do
- Own the team’s deliverables, working with the Scrum Master to define a clear delivery path aligned to customer requirements.
- Lead and contribute across the entire CI/CD lifecycle, including requirements gathering, design, implementation, testing and deployment.
- Collaborate with cross‑functional teams, including product, front‑end development and QA, to ensure integrated delivery.
- Mentor and guide junior developers, helping to grow capability and support career development across the team.
What We’re Looking For
- Experience as a DevOps Engineer with strong expertise in CI/CD, containerisation, deployment technologies, and cloud platforms (Jenkins, Kubernetes, IaC, Docker, AWS).
- Proven experience in designing, developing and deploying CI/CD solutions.
- Experience in Linux system administration or similar operating systems.
- Ability to troubleshoot issues across live production environments, including high‑level networking, server and application issues.
- Understanding of database technologies such as SQL, Elasticsearch or MongoDB.
- Excellent communication, collaboration and problem‑solving skills, ideally with experience working in an agile environment.
